What role do mythical creatures in medieval art play in fantasy literature?

Mythical creatures depicted in medieval art often serve as the template for similar beings in fantasy literature. Creatures like dragons, griffins, and unicorns, frequently illustrated in medieval manuscripts and bestiaries, are extensively used in fantasy settings. These mythological beings enrich the narrative by imbuing the story with elements of wonder and adventure, challenging characters to confront the unknown and often reflecting thematic elements such as power, magic, and mystery inherent in the genre.
